Located on hills overlooking downtown San Diego and the bay, Mission Hills is an affluent, historic neighborhood with a distinct village-like atmosphere. Its tree-lined streets are celebrated for beautiful Craftsman, Spanish Colonial, and mid-century homes. The walkable business district boasts local restaurants and boutiques, creating a peaceful, scenic retreat just minutes from downtown.
